Lifts, also known as elevators, are an essential part of modern buildings, transporting people and goods between floors. But have you ever wondered how these marvels of engineering actually work? There are two main types of elevator mechanisms: hydraulic and traction.

Hydraulic Lifts: Pushing Up with Power

Imagine a giant syringe. Hydraulic lifts use a similar principle. A piston sits inside a cylinder filled with hydraulic fluid. When a pump forces fluid into the cylinder, the piston extends, pushing the elevator car upwards. To descend, a valve opens, allowing the fluid to flow back into a reservoir, and the car lowers under its own weight.

Hydraulic lifts are common in low-rise buildings, typically up to six or seven floors. They are relatively simple and cost-effective but have limitations. The length of the cylinder restricts travel height, and they are not as energy-efficient as traction lifts.

Traction Lifts: The Balancing Act

Traction lifts, the most common type in high-rise buildings, use a system of ropes, pulleys, and a counterweight. Steel ropes connect the elevator car to a sheave (a grooved pulley) powered by an electric motor. As the motor turns, the sheave rotates, pulling the ropes and lifting the car.

Here's the clever part: a counterweight, typically made of concrete blocks, hangs on the other end of the ropes. The weight of the counterweight almost balances the weight of the elevator car. This means the motor only needs to exert enough force to overcome the difference in weight and friction, making it more energy-efficient than hydraulic lifts.

In addition to the main lifting mechanism, both hydraulic and traction lifts rely on a sophisticated control system. This system includes sensors that detect floor level, call buttons, and safety features like brakes and governors to ensure a smooth and safe ride.
